WOW! That what I call a nice news! In Japan we're lucky to be able to
use CDMA-EVDO phones with their 2.4Mbps Max speed data, and in addition
to this high speed, we also have flat-fee rates. Hitachi is working on
a VNC version of a BREW mobile phone like this W21s (the one that I am
using daily as a matter of fact). So soon, you will be able (in Japan
and maybe elsewhere later on) to control your PC, MAC or UNIX station
from your 3G phone while you are having a drink on a nice terrace. As
you can see it even works on every BREW enabled phone like this Nokia. Related Links:
